Avoid propagation of full build host specific path into
WORKDIR/sysroot-destdir/usr/share/cmake/ZeroMQ/ZeroMQTargets.cmake
when building the recipe as this causes following-like breakage on
sstate cache consumer hosts (with different build host specific path,
than the host that populated sstate cache)
ninja: error: '/build/host/specific/path/to/zeromq/4.3.2-r0/recipe-sysroot/usr/lib/libsodium.so', needed by 'src/FooBar', missing and no known rule to make it

The complete Changes since 4.31 are:
4.33 Wed Mar 18 13:22:29 CET 2020
- the 4.31 timerfd code wrongly changed the priority of the signal
fd watcher, which is usually harmless unless signal fds are
also used (found via cpan tester service).
- the documentation wrongly claimed that user may modify fd and events
members in io watchers when the watcher was stopped
(found by b_jonas).
- new ev_io_modify mutator which changes only the events member,
which can be faster. also added ev::io::set (int events) method
to ev++.h.
- officially allow a zero events mask for io watchers. this should
work with older libev versions as well but was not officially
allowed before.
- do not wake up every minute when timerfd is used to detect timejumps.
- do not wake up every minute when periodics are disabled and we have
a monotonic clock.
- support a lot more "uncommon" compile time configurations,
such as ev_embed enabled but ev_timer disabled.
- use a start/stop wrapper class to reduce code duplication in
ev++.h and make it needlessly more c++-y.
- the linux aio backend is no longer compiled in by default.
- update to libecb version 0x00010008.

Overview of changes in libqmi 1.24.6
----------------------------------------
* libqmi-glib:
** Fixed the close operation logic to make sure that a reopen done right
away doesn't close the wrong endpoint.
** Updated string reading logic to make sure that all strings are valid
UTF-8.
** Updated string reading logic to attempt parsing as GSM7 or UCS2 if the
initial UTF-8 validation fails.
*+ Renamed TLV 0x15 in the "WDA Get Data Format" message, and added new
compat methods for the old name.
** Fixed the format of the NITZ information TLV, and added new compat
methods for the old name.
** Fixed the format of the Home Network 3GPP2 TLV, and added new compat
methods for the old name.
* Several other minor improvements and fixes.
